Robert was much shorter than Black Python and White Python, so he had to speak with his head tilted upward.

After exchanging a few words, Robert handed the microphone to White Python.

Looking at the freshmen below the stage, White Python was solemn and strict as he greeted, “Hello, students. I am your military training instructor for this year—White Python!”

When he introduced himself, the audience couldn’t help but gasp. Even his name is domineering!

“Sir, if your name is White Python, then the one next to you must be called Black Python, right?” The students in the audience quipped.

Black Python’s thin lips curled up in a smile as he took the microphone from his counterpart. He spoke in a steady and powerful voice. “Yes, I am your deputy instructor—Black Python!”

At that, the audience erupted into a cheer.

Robert nodded with gratification. It seemed that Black Python and White Python were fine after all!
